KAFKA_DATA_LOSS felklass
Vissa data kan ha gått förlorade eftersom de inte längre är tillgängliga i Kafka. antingen har data föråldrades ut av Kafka eller så kan ämnet ha tagits bort innan alla data i ämnet bearbetades. Om du inte vill att strömningsfrågan ska misslyckas i sådana fall anger du källalternativet failOnDataLoss till false. Förnuft:
LÄGGD_PARTITION_STARTAR_INTE_FRÅN_OFFSET_NOLL
Partitionen <topicPartition>
som har lagts till startar från <startOffset>
istället för 0.
KAN_INTE_LÄSA_OFFSET_OMRÅDE
Det gick inte att läsa poster i förskjutningen [<startOffset>
, <endOffset>
) för ämnespartition <topicPartition>
med konsumentgruppen <groupId>
.
INITIAL_OFFSET_EJ_FUNNET_FÖR_PARTITIONER
Det går inte att hitta inledande förskjutningar för partitioner <partitions>
. De kan ha tagits bort.
PARTITIONER_RADERADE
Partitioner <partitions>
har tagits bort.
PARTITIONER_BORTTAGNA_OCH_GRUPPID_KONFIGURATION_FINNS
Partitioner <partitions>
har tagits bort.
Kafka alternativ "kafka.<groupIdConfig>
" har ställts in på den här frågan är det
rekommenderas inte att ange det här alternativet. Det här alternativet är osäkert att använda eftersom flera samtidiga
frågor eller källor som använder samma grupp-ID stör varandra eftersom de är en del av
samma konsumentgrupp. Omstartade frågor kan också drabbas av störningar från
tidigare körning med samma grupp-ID. Användaren ska endast ha en fråga per grupp-ID.
och/eller ange alternativet "kafka.session.timeout.ms" till ett mycket litet värde så att Kafka
konsumenter från föregående förfrågan markeras som döda av Kafka-gruppkoordinatorn innan de
Omstartad fråga börjar köras.
PARTITION_OFFSET_CHANGED
Partitionsförskjutningen <topicPartition>
har ändrats från <prevOffset>
till <newOffset>
.
START_OFFSET_RESET
Startförskjutningen för <topicPartition>
var <offset>
men återställdes av konsumenten till <fetchedOffset>
.